The Berlin RecSys get-together (in German: Stammtisch) is an informal meeting (we also have talks and demos, though!) of people interested in recommender systems and personalization. So far we have met 9 times. The next meeting will be in November.

Past talks
- Jimmy Lin: WTF: the who to follow service at Twitter
- Mikio Braun: Online Learning with Stream Minig
- Ted Dunning: Bayesian A/B Testing applied to recommenders
- Sebastian Schelter: New Directions in Mahout’s Recommenders
- Torben Brodt: The Plista Recommender Challenge
- Jonas Dose: Real-time advertisting
- Torben Brodt: Content Recommendations with Redis
- Paul Lamere: I've got 10 million songs in my pocket. Now what?
- Brian McFee: Modeling playlists by context
- Oscar Celma: MusicDiscoBerry: the bittersweet high-hanging fruit
- Ben Fields: A brief history of playlist generatio
- Alan Said: State of RecSys: Recap of Recsys 2012
- Zeno Gantner: MyMediaLite Hands-on Recommender System Experiments with MyMediaLite
